What size tires are you running? The fronts look tall. Maybe it's just the drop that's needed, though.....

the rears are 285/25 and the fronts are 245/35 i believe.

If the fronts are 245/35, then you've got the wrong size. You should be running a 245/30 with a 285/25. Your front tire is 1.2" taller than your rear tire.
